1-Propylnaphthalen-2-ol is an organic compound with the molecular formula C13H14O. It is a derivative of naphthalen-2-ol, where a propyl group (a three-carbon alkyl chain) is attached to the 1-position of the naphthalene ring. 1-propylnaphthalen-2-ol is characterized by its aromatic structure, with a hydroxyl group (-OH) attached to the 2-position of the naphthalene ring, which can participate in hydrogen bonding and other chemical reactions. 1-Propylnaphthalen-2-ol is a colorless to pale yellow liquid with a distinct aromatic odor. It is used in the synthesis of various pharmaceuticals, agrochemicals, and other specialty chemicals due to its unique chemical properties and reactivity.

Check Digit Verification of cas no

The CAS Registry Mumber 17324-09-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,7,3,2 and 4 respectively; the second part has 2 digits, 0 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 17324-09:
(7*1)+(6*7)+(5*3)+(4*2)+(3*4)+(2*0)+(1*9)=93
93 % 10 = 3
So 17324-09-3 is a valid CAS Registry Number.

Excited-State Proton Transfer from Hydroxyalkylnaphthols

Tolbert, Laren M.,Harvey, Lilia Cuesta,Lum, Rachel C.

, p. 13335 - 13340 (1993)

The excited-state proton-transfer (ESPT) reactions of 1-propyl-2-naphthol (PN), 1-(3-hydroxypropyl)-2-naphthol (HPN), and 1-(2,3-dihydroxypropyl)-2-naphthol (DPN) in aqueous methanol solutions have been investigated.The hydroxypropyl and dihydroxypropyl side chains have a pronounced effect on the rate of the proton transfer and on the number of water molecules involved, indicating that proton transfer in alcoholic solvents is more complex than simple models of water clusters can accommodate.Altarnative models in which a side chain facilitates the formation of the requisite geometry for proton transfer are discussed.
